Outline of Final Research Achievements

GPGPU techniques, which utilize graphic processors to accelerate general purpose computing, have become popular in the past several years. In this study, we developed a technique for efficiently executing discrete event simulations (DES) using GPGPU. Processing branches lead performance degradation in GPGPU. Thus we reduced the branches by introducing temporal redundancy. Moreover, we developed a number of software rejuvenation schemes for parallel DES. We also constructed an analytical model for evaluating reliability of a simple software rejuvenation technique.
